About the author

Andrew Soltis is an International Grandmaster and chess correspondent for the New York Times and a highly popular chess writer. He is the author of many books including 500 Chess Questions Answered, The Chessmaster Checklist, and How to Swindle in Chess: Snatch Victory from a Losing Position. He currently lives in New York.
